Lines Matching refs:s_mutex
136 mutex_t s_mutex;
150 NOTE(MUTEX_PROTECTS_DATA(Elf_Scn::s_mutex, Elf_Scn Dnode Elf_Data))
164 #define SCNLOCK(x) (void) mutex_lock(&((Elf_Scn *)x)->s_mutex);
168 (void) mutex_lock(&((Elf_Scn *)x)->s_mutex);
172 #define SCNUNLOCK(x) (void) mutex_unlock(&((Elf_Scn *)x)->s_mutex);
176 (void) mutex_unlock(&((Elf_Scn *)x)->s_mutex);
181 (void) mutex_unlock(&((Elf_Scn *)s)->s_mutex); \
187 (void) mutex_unlock(&((Elf_Scn *)s)->s_mutex); \
197 (void) mutex_lock(&((Elf_Scn *)s)->s_mutex);
203 (void) mutex_lock(&((Elf_Scn *)s)->s_mutex); \
210 (void) mutex_lock(&((Elf_Scn *)s)->s_mutex);
215 (void) mutex_lock(&((Elf_Scn *)s)->s_mutex); \
221 (void) mutex_unlock(&((Elf_Scn *)s)->s_mutex); \
226 (void) mutex_unlock(&((Elf_Scn *)s)->s_mutex); \
354 NOTE(RWLOCK_COVERS_LOCKS(Elf::ed_rwlock, Elf_Scn::s_mutex))